Welcome to the 23rd edition of the World Bowl, hosted by The Holy Republic of Estope. Estope is a relatively small, nation located in Esportiva. Sports are a huge deal in Estope as almost everyone either plays a sport or actively follows Estope's national teams. Baseball, Tennis, and Soccer are the major sports in Estope, but Football, or Gridiron as it is referred to as, is also a very popular sport. Outside of Sports, Estope is a very conservative and religious nation. Almost the entire population is Catholic, which is the national religion. There are still some other Christians and even non-Christians, although they do have to pay a larger tax. That being said people are still very free and so foreigners will not have to worry about any ridiculous laws. Most laws are based off of the Ten Commandments so as long as those are followed there shouldn't be any trouble. There are very few restrictions on guns, although they will not be allowed in the stadiums except by security guards, and many people carry concealed weapons on them. There is very little crime in Estope so any visitors will be safe. Twin Brooks, the host of the World Bowl, is the capital of Estope. It is a very large city and the center of everything in Estope. The city is very clean and there are many options for hotels, dining, and entertainment. More info to be added later.
